Lua Errors - v4.0.4 #355


  • Invalid
Closed
Assigned to zimzarina
  • Xogue29 created this issue Oct 17, 2023

    So the setup is that I was unaware of the "clear list" option within the mod (maybe have the option in multiple places, or a more obvious one? just a thought) so I went through the list under the "alts" menu and deleted every toon in there one by one, started with about 13 or so.

     

    After this, I get several Lua errors. The first is when I load the game:

    1 / 3:

    Message: Interface/AddOns/Postal/Postal.lua:135: attempt to index field 'global' (a nil value)
    Time: Tue Oct 17 14:09:28 2023
    Count: 1
    Stack: Interface/AddOns/Postal/Postal.lua:135: attempt to index field 'global' (a nil value)
    [string "=(tail call)"]: ?
    [string "@Interface/AddOns/Postal/Postal.lua"]:135: in function <Interface/AddOns/Postal/Postal.lua:117>
    [string "=[C]"]: ?
    [string "@Interface/AddOns/ChatCleaner/Libs/AceAddon-3.0/AceAddon-3.0.lua"]:66: in function <...ddOns/ChatCleaner/Libs/AceAddon-3.0/AceAddon-3.0.lua:61>
    [string "@Interface/AddOns/ChatCleaner/Libs/AceAddon-3.0/AceAddon-3.0.lua"]:494: in function `InitializeAddon'
    [string "@Interface/AddOns/ChatCleaner/Libs/AceAddon-3.0/AceAddon-3.0.lua"]:619: in function <...ddOns/ChatCleaner/Libs/AceAddon-3.0/AceAddon-3.0.lua:611>
    
    Locals: (*temporary) = <function> defined =[C]:-1
    

     

    2 / 3:

    Message: Interface/AddOns/Postal/Modules/BlackBook.lua:57: attempt to index field 'db' (a nil value)
    Time: Tue Oct 17 14:09:35 2023
    Count: 1
    Stack: Interface/AddOns/Postal/Modules/BlackBook.lua:57: attempt to index field 'db' (a nil value)
    [string "=(tail call)"]: ?
    [string "@Interface/AddOns/Postal/Modules/BlackBook.lua"]:57: in function <Interface/AddOns/Postal/Modules/BlackBook.lua:36>
    [string "=[C]"]: ?
    [string "@Interface/AddOns/ChatCleaner/Libs/AceAddon-3.0/AceAddon-3.0.lua"]:66: in function <...ddOns/ChatCleaner/Libs/AceAddon-3.0/AceAddon-3.0.lua:61>
    [string "@Interface/AddOns/ChatCleaner/Libs/AceAddon-3.0/AceAddon-3.0.lua"]:523: in function `EnableAddon'
    [string "@Interface/AddOns/ChatCleaner/Libs/AceAddon-3.0/AceAddon-3.0.lua"]:536: in function `EnableAddon'
    [string "@Interface/AddOns/ChatCleaner/Libs/AceAddon-3.0/AceAddon-3.0.lua"]:626: in function <...ddOns/ChatCleaner/Libs/AceAddon-3.0/AceAddon-3.0.lua:611>
    
    Locals: (*temporary) = <function> defined =[C]:-1
    

     

    3 / 3:

    Message: Interface/AddOns/Postal/Modules/QuickAttach.lua:233: attempt to index field 'db' (a nil value)
    Time: Tue Oct 17 14:09:35 2023
    Count: 1
    Stack: Interface/AddOns/Postal/Modules/QuickAttach.lua:233: attempt to index field 'db' (a nil value)
    [string "=(tail call)"]: ?
    [string "@Interface/AddOns/Postal/Modules/QuickAttach.lua"]:233: in function `Postal_QuickAttachGetQAButtonCharName'
    [string "@Interface/AddOns/Postal/Modules/QuickAttach.lua"]:41: in function <Interface/AddOns/Postal/Modules/QuickAttach.lua:28>
    [string "@Interface/AddOns/Postal/Modules/QuickAttach.lua"]:122: in function <Interface/AddOns/Postal/Modules/QuickAttach.lua:66>
    [string "=[C]"]: ?
    [string "@Interface/AddOns/ChatCleaner/Libs/AceAddon-3.0/AceAddon-3.0.lua"]:66: in function <...ddOns/ChatCleaner/Libs/AceAddon-3.0/AceAddon-3.0.lua:61>
    [string "@Interface/AddOns/ChatCleaner/Libs/AceAddon-3.0/AceAddon-3.0.lua"]:523: in function `EnableAddon'
    [string "@Interface/AddOns/ChatCleaner/Libs/AceAddon-3.0/AceAddon-3.0.lua"]:536: in function `EnableAddon'
    [string "@Interface/AddOns/ChatCleaner/Libs/AceAddon-3.0/AceAddon-3.0.lua"]:626: in function <...ddOns/ChatCleaner/Libs/AceAddon-3.0/AceAddon-3.0.lua:611>
    
    Locals: (*temporary) = <function> defined =[C]:-1
    

     

    Then when I open a mailbox:

    Message: Interface/AddOns/Postal/Modules/Express.lua:23: attempt to index field 'db' (a nil value)
    Time: Tue Oct 17 14:15:08 2023
    Count: 1
    Stack: Interface/AddOns/Postal/Modules/Express.lua:23: attempt to index field 'db' (a nil value)
    [string "=[C]"]: ?
    [string "@Interface/AddOns/Postal/Modules/Express.lua"]:23: in function `MAIL_SHOW'
    [string "@Interface/AddOns/Postal/Modules/Express.lua"]:14: in function `?'
    [string "@Interface/AddOns/ChatCleaner/Libs/CallbackHandler-1.0/CallbackHandler-1.0.lua"]:109: in function <...ner/Libs/CallbackHandler-1.0/CallbackHandler-1.0.lua:109>
    [string "=[C]"]: ?
    [string "@Interface/AddOns/ChatCleaner/Libs/CallbackHandler-1.0/CallbackHandler-1.0.lua"]:19: in function <...ner/Libs/CallbackHandler-1.0/CallbackHandler-1.0.lua:15>
    [string "@Interface/AddOns/ChatCleaner/Libs/CallbackHandler-1.0/CallbackHandler-1.0.lua"]:54: in function `Fire'
    [string "@Interface/AddOns/ChatCleaner/Libs/AceEvent-3.0/AceEvent-3.0.lua"]:120: in function <...ddOns/ChatCleaner/Libs/AceEvent-3.0/AceEvent-3.0.lua:119>
    [string "=[C]"]: in function `TurnOrActionStop'
    [string "TURNORACTION"]:4: in function <[string "TURNORACTION"]:1>
    
    Locals: (*temporary) = <function> defined =[C]:-1
    

     

    and finally when I try to click the arrow next to the "To:" Field.

    Message: Interface/AddOns/Postal/Modules/BlackBook.lua:413: attempt to index field 'db' (a nil value)
    Time: Tue Oct 17 14:15:47 2023
    Count: 1
    Stack: Interface/AddOns/Postal/Modules/BlackBook.lua:413: attempt to index field 'db' (a nil value)
    [string "=[C]"]: ?
    [string "@Interface/AddOns/Postal/Modules/BlackBook.lua"]:413: in function `initFunction'
    [string "@Interface/SharedXML/UIDropDownMenu.lua"]:80: in function `UIDropDownMenu_Initialize'
    [string "@Interface/SharedXML/UIDropDownMenu.lua"]:1166: in function <Interface/SharedXML/UIDropDownMenu.lua:1023>
    [string "=[C]"]: in function `ToggleDropDownMenu'
    [string "@Interface/AddOns/Postal/Modules/BlackBook.lua"]:52: in function <Interface/AddOns/Postal/Modules/BlackBook.lua:47>
    
    Locals: (*temporary) = <function> defined =[C]:-1
    

     

    It does reference other mods in some cases, but the only change made was to postal, and not all of them reference the other mods. postal is the only common factor. Clearly I did things the wrong way, and I am guessing I need to clear out whatever files are left over after removing a mod since deleting and reinstalling do not fix it either, but I wanted to drop this here just in case it is helpful to you.

  • Zimzarina posted a comment Oct 18, 2023

    Can you please attach your personal Postal settings file to this report, and I will take a look.  The default location for this file is C:\Program Files (x86)\World of Warcraft\_retail_\WTF\Account\<Account Name>\SavedVariables\Postal.lua

  • Zimzarina self-assigned this issue Oct 18, 2023
  • Zimzarina closed issue Oct 25, 2023
  • Zimzarina posted a comment Oct 25, 2023

    Waited a week for a response from poster, but never received one.  Closing this issue as no response or further reports.

  • Zimzarina added a tag Invalid Oct 25, 2023

To post a comment, please login or register a new account.